How Vacuum Mop Cleaner Robots Work: A Symphony of Technology
The magic behind vacuum mop cleaner robotics lies in their intricate blend of software and hardware. These devices flawlessly integrate vacuuming and mopping abilities, operating autonomously to deliver a comprehensive cleaning experience. Understanding their inner functions is crucial to appreciating their effectiveness and choosing the right model for particular requirements.
At their core, vacuum mop cleaner robots employ a combination of innovations to navigate and tidy efficiently. Here's a breakdown of their key operational components:
Navigation and Mapping: Modern robot vacuum mops use sophisticated navigation systems to comprehend and map their cleaning environment. Numerous high-end designs use LiDAR (Light Detection and Ranging) innovation, which uses lasers to produce an in-depth map of the room. try what he says permits efficient cleaning courses, systematic room coverage, and challenge avoidance. Other robots may make use of camera-based visual SLAM (Simultaneous Localization and Mapping) or rely on infrared sensing units and gyroscopes for navigation. Easier designs might use a more random or bounce-based navigation system, which, while less effective, still finishes the job over time.
Vacuuming System: The vacuuming function is normally powered by a motor that develops suction. This suction, combined with rotating brushes below the robot, raises dust, dirt, pet hair, and other particles from the floor. Gathered debris is then transported into an internal dustbin. The suction power and brush design can differ between designs, affecting their efficiency on various floor types and in getting different kinds of dirt.
Mopping System: This is where vacuum mop robotics really separate themselves. They are equipped with a water tank and a mopping pad. Water is dispensed onto the pad, which is then dragged or turned across the floor surface. Various designs utilize numerous mopping mechanisms:
- Dragging Mop Pads: These are the most basic and most typical. The robot drags a wet microfiber pad across the floor.
- Vibrating Mop Pads: Some robotics include vibrating mop pads that scrub the floor more effectively, loosening tougher discolorations and grime.
- Turning Mop Pads: More innovative models make use of turning mop pads that mimic manual mopping actions, offering a deeper tidy and better stain removal abilities.
- Sonic Mopping: Premium robotics include sonic vibration innovation, producing high-frequency vibrations in the mopping pad for extremely efficient scrubbing.
Sensing units and Intelligence: A range of sensing units are vital for robot operation. Cliff sensors prevent robots from falling down stairs. Bump sensing units find challenges. Wall sensors allow for edge cleaning. The robot's software and algorithms procedure sensing unit information to make smart choices about cleaning courses, barrier avoidance, and going back to the charging dock when the battery is low or cleaning is total. Lots of robots now offer smart device app combination, enabling functions like scheduling, zone cleaning, and real-time tracking.

Navigating the Market: Types of Vacuum Mop Robots
The marketplace for vacuum mop cleaner robotics is varied, with different designs accommodating different needs and budget plans. Comprehending the different types can help you make an educated option:
2-in-1 Vacuum and Mop Robots: These are the most typical type, combining both vacuuming and mopping functionalities in a single unit. They typically change in between modes or operate both concurrently depending upon the model.
Devoted Vacuum Robots with Mopping Attachment: Some robots are mostly designed for vacuuming but use a detachable mopping module. These might be an excellent choice for those who focus on strong vacuuming abilities however want occasional mopping performance.
Dry Mopping vs. Wet Mopping Robots: While essentially all “mop” robots provide damp mopping to some degree, some are much better suited for mostly dry sweeping and light moist mopping for dust elimination. Others are developed for more robust damp mopping with features like adjustable water circulation and scrubbing pads.
Navigation Technology Based Classification:
- LiDAR Navigation Robots: Offer the most accurate navigation, effective cleaning courses, and advanced functions like space mapping, zone cleaning, and no-go zones.
- Camera-Based Navigation Robots: Use visual SLAM for mapping and navigation, often providing great coverage and object recognition.
- Infrared and Gyroscope Navigation Robots: More affordable options that use sensors and gyroscopes for navigation, typically less organized and efficient than LiDAR or camera-based systems.
- Random/Bounce Navigation Robots: Basic designs that move randomly, altering direction upon experiencing barriers. While less efficient, they can still clean effectively over time, specifically in smaller sized areas.
Feature-Based Classification:
- Self-Emptying Robots: These robotics immediately empty their dustbins into a larger base station, considerably decreasing upkeep frequency.
- App-Controlled Robots: Offer smartphone app integration for scheduling, push-button control, zone cleaning, real-time mapping, and more.
- Smart Home Integration Robots: Compatible with voice assistants like Alexa or Google Assistant, permitting voice-activated cleaning commands and automation within smart home environments.

Keeping Your Robot Running Smoothly: Maintenance and Care
To ensure your vacuum mop robot continues to perform optimally and enjoys a long life expectancy, regular upkeep is necessary. Simple maintenance jobs can substantially affect its effectiveness and longevity:
- Empty the Dustbin Regularly: This is vital for maintaining suction power. Empty the dustbin after each cleaning cycle or as regularly as advised by the manufacturer. For self-emptying robotics, make sure the base station dustbin is likewise emptied occasionally.
- Clean the Brushes: Hair, threads, and debris can get tangled in the brushes. Routinely eliminate and clean up the brushes to keep their efficiency. Some robots come with cleaning tools particularly designed for this purpose.
- Clean or Replace Filters: Filters trap dust and irritants. Regularly tidy or change filters according to the maker's instructions to preserve excellent air quality and suction.
- Clean the Mopping Pads: Wash or change mopping pads routinely to preserve health and mopping effectiveness. Follow the maker's guidelines for cleaning or replacing pads.
- Inspect and Clean Sensors: Sensors are important for navigation. Occasionally tidy sensors with a soft, dry fabric to guarantee they are totally free from dust and debris, preserving accurate navigation.
- Keep Water Tank (if relevant): For robotics with water tanks, regularly clean the tank and guarantee it is free of mineral buildup. Usage distilled water if advised by the maker to prevent mineral deposits.
- Software application Updates: If your robot is app-controlled, keep the robot's firmware and app updated to benefit from efficiency enhancements and new functions.

Q: Can robot vacuum mops change regular vacuums and mops completely?A: For daily cleaning and maintenance, they can considerably decrease or perhaps get rid of the requirement for traditional vacuums and mops. Nevertheless, for deep cleaning, dealing with big spills, or cleaning upholstery and other surfaces, you may still need a conventional vacuum or mop.
Q: Do robot vacuum mops work on all floor types?A: Most contemporary robots work well on difficult floors like tile, hardwood, laminate, and vinyl. Numerous can also handle low-pile carpets and rugs. However, extremely thick carpets or shag rugs might present difficulties for some designs. Always examine the manufacturer's specifications for floor type compatibility.
Q: What type of maintenance is needed for a vacuum mop robot?A: Regular maintenance includes clearing the dustbin, cleaning brushes, cleaning or changing filters, cleaning mopping pads, and regularly cleaning sensors. Upkeep frequency differs depending upon use and the particular design.
Q: How long do vacuum mop robots generally last?A: The life-span of a robot vacuum mop depends on usage, upkeep, and develop quality. On average, with appropriate care, a good quality robot can last for a number of years (3-5 years or more). Battery life might deteriorate with time and might ultimately need replacement.

Q: How loud are vacuum mop robots?A: Noise levels differ between models. Typically, they are quieter than traditional vacuum cleaners. Numerous run at a noise level equivalent to a quiet discussion. Some models provide a “peaceful mode” for even quieter operation.
Q: Can I utilize cleaning services in the water tank of a robot mop?A: It is important to examine the maker's recommendations. Some robots are created to just use plain water in the water tank. Utilizing particular cleaning services can harm the robot or void the service warranty. If permitted, utilize just mild, diluted cleaning services specifically authorized for robot mops.
